Abstract

The placenta accreta spectrum is on rise. If the placenta is covering the entire anterior uterine wall, there are definite challenges involved in delivering the fetus without exsanguination and with minimal maternal blood loss. We present a case report that highlights the use of transverse uterine fundal incision (TFUI) in an anterior placenta previa with accreta involving the entire uterine wall. It can be considered as an option to vertical uterine incision in such cases where the patient is not desirous of future fertility and caesarean hysterectomy is planned
